Trident Will Build World's Tallest Residential Tower in Dubai

March 13 (Bloomberg) -- Construction of the world's tallest residential tower will start in Dubai by the end of the year, with the 160 apartments each selling for a minimum of $2.4 million.

The 516 meter-building (1,693 feet) will have two 120-storey towers, with a total of 160 apartments. Each apartment, known as a pentominium will occupy at least one floor and will have at least 6,500 square feet of space, closely held Trident International Holdings said today at the MIPIM real estate conference in Cannes, France.
